What is the Qualifier Exam Registration Form?
The Qualifier Exam Registration Form serves a crucial purpose for students at ITT Dublin. This form requires students to provide essential details, including various subjects they intend to sit and personal information such as their name and ID number. Meeting registration deadlines is vital, as late submissions can jeopardize a student's eligibility to take their desired exams.
Completing the qualifier exam form accurately ensures a smooth registration process, greatly affecting exam scheduling and student performance.

Key Features of the Qualifier Exam Registration Form
The Qualifier Exam Registration Form consists of several essential sections, each playing a significant role in the registration process. Key form components include:
-
Personal information fields: Name, mobile number, ID number, and course details.
-
Subject selection: A clear indication of the subjects the student intends to take.
-
Payment details: Sections to input payment information for exam fees.
-
Signature line: An essential part for confirming the authenticity of the submission.
Each fillable field significantly contributes to ensuring a successful registration.
